Documenti di Didattica
Documenti di Professioni
Documenti di Cultura
E JOSE GRANDA
Historial de Revisiones
Fecha 30/05/2013 Versin 1.0 Descripcin Documento inicial Autor Crespo Merino, Luis
Page 2
Tabla de Contenidos
1. Introduccin 1.1. Propsito 1.2. Alcance 1.3. Definicin, Acrnimos, y Abreviaturas 1.4. Referencias Subsistemas 2.1. Capa de Vistas 2.2. Capa de Control 2.3. Capa de Modelo Construccin 4 4 4 4 4 5 5 6 7 8
2.
3.
Page 3
Modelo de implementacin
1. Introduccin 1.1 Propsito Muestra las dependencias entre las partes de cdigo del sistema y la estructura del sistema en ejecucin, mostrado en tres capas: Capa de Vista, Capa de Control, y la Capa de Modelo. 1.2 Alcance Este documento aplica al Mdulo de Recepcin de Libros de la Biblioteca I.E. Jos Granda. 1.3 Definicin, Acrnimos, y Abreviaturas GUI: (Interfaz Grfica de Usuario) Conjunto de formas y mtodos que posibilitan la interaccin de un sistema con los usuarios utilizando formas grficas e imgenes. Las formas grficas se refieren a botones, conos, ventanas, fuentes, etc. Microsoft SQL Server: Es un sistema para la gestin de base de datos producido por Microsoft basado en el modelo relacional. Caracterizado por soportar procedimientos almacenados, contar con un entorno grfico para la ejecucin de comandos, permitir el poder trabajar en modo cliente-servidor, etc. 1.4 Referencias - Propuesta de Arquitectura Inicial. - Arquitectura de Referencia.
Page 4
2. Subsistemas 2.1 Capa de Vistas En esta capa encontramos el paquete Interfaz de usuario (GUI), en donde se encuentran todos los elementos con los que el usuario podr interactuar con el sistema, es decir aqu se hallan las ventanas. Este subsistema realiza la toma los datos que el usuario ingresara en los formularios.
I_Consulta
I_Prestamo
I_Devolucion
I_Multa
I_ListarLibros
I_PagMulta
I_ListarMultados
Page 5
2.2 Capa de Control En esta capa encontramos a la lgica del negocio y las entidades que son parte del negocio en s. Aqu se encuentran las reglas, restricciones, etc. Este subsistema se encargara de corregir los datos obtenidos de la interfaz de acuerdo a las reglas de negocio y a los atributos de las entidades.
C_Prestamo
C_Consulta
C_Devolucion
C_Libro
C_Multa
Page 6
2.3 Capa de Modelo En esta capa encontramos las clases que el sistema utiliza para manejar la persistencia de los objetos con la Base de Datos. Este subsistema realiza la ejecucin de las sentencias para la conexin, almacenamiento, modificacin, y obtencin de datos de la base de datos.
E_Prestamo
E_Multa
E_Lector
E_Libro
E_Devolucion
Page 7
3. Construccin Por medio de la autentificacin se tiene acceso a los formularios de la capa vista, aqu el usuario ingresara a las ventanas que desea utilizar para realizar una funcionalidad. Una vez ingresado la informacin, estas pasaran a la capa de datos, donde se realizara la correccin de los datos que se ingresaron de acuerdo a las reglas del negocio y a las propiedades de los atributos de cada entidad, cuando los datos sean correctos estos sern enviados a la capa de almacenamiento, la cual se encargara de ejecutar las sentencias para seleccionar, insertar, modificar los datos dentro de la base de datos de SQL Server.
Page 8